In the COUNT mode the scale will count using the last stored sampling count by the user Tare Zero Press to tare or set the scale to zero when a container is used It is possible to tare in the Counting Mode also With small weights the tare key will zero the display and for big weights it will tare and T blinks on the left upper corner of the LCD indicating the scale is in TARE mode Calibrating the scale If the accuracy of the scale decreases then the scale may need the recalibration Press AUTOCAL key to enter scale s user calibration mode After entering the user calibration the scale will ask for the 2kg weight After putting the 2kg the scale will re calibrate itself and prompts Success in the first line of the LCD When the weight placed on the platform is not equal to 2kg then the scale will keep on asking for the 2kg weight This is to protect from mis calibration Operating Temperature The scale is designed to operate normal room temperatures If subjected cold or warm temperatures it should be allowed to reach room temperature before operating Operate on a Firm Flat Calm Level surface In order to operate correctly the scale must be installed on a firm level flat surface Note As this scale is of 0 1g resolution even a slight air blow will cause the display instable so please make sure the environment is calm with no air blowing
2. the scale The display will show c Elane and the scale software version for sometime Now the scale is ready for weighing and counting This is the normal mode of the scale and by default after start up Grams displays on the first line of the LCD and 0 0 displays on the second Operating the scale Weighing Pressing the corresponding button labeled with the specific unit of measurement will change to that unit of weight Counting There are two types of counting method 1 User can count as per the default sampling count number the current sampling count saved in memory 2 User can input his own sampling count number and store as default Setting a new sampling count number Press the SAMPLE key when the scale is in normal mode The scale displays Input ct and then press the corresponding key that represents the desired sampling counts The numbers will be added up in the second line of the LCD as you press a key e g pressing GRAMS 10 will add 10 to the current count When the desired number is displayed on the LCD press the SAMPLE key Now the scale will ask to put the items weight you should put exactly the sample quantity that you just input The scale will memorize the weight and count of the scale and then it will start counting in reference to this new number To cancel sampling press COUNT key during sampling Note For the better performance please take as many sampling items number as possible

ERROR DISPLAY Overload When the weight placed on the platform is greater than the capacity of the scale Overload displays on the second line of the LCD Remove weight Displays when the scale is started on a not stable surface or started with the weight on the platform or when the scale zero frequency is higher than the predefined range Underload Displays when the scale zero frequency is lower than the predefined range on the start up EL ANE Electronic Precision Scale Max 3000g d 0 1g OPERATING MANUAL SCALE FEATURES Weighing Weighs in five different modes Carat Ounces Troy Ounces Grains Grams Counting User can define the sampling number for counting mode SPECIFICATIONS 12 6cm X 14cm Mains via 9 Volts Main Adapter Platform Size Power supply e Capacity 3000g e Graduation Resolution 0 1g e Minimum Weight gt 0 3g e Accuracy 99 8 e Power consumption Approx 0 35 watts e Tare Unlimited not excluding the scale range e Weight of Unit Scale 520g e Dimensions 20cm X 14 5cm X 5 3cm e e Preparing the scale for use As the load cell of the scale is very sensitive protective foams are inserted in between the platform and the upper case Please remove these protective foams before using the scale Place the scale on a firm level surface Plug the mains adaptor supplied with the scale into the mains and connect the adapter s output plug to the input socket at the rear of
